Dermatologists recommend a fresh face towel every single use. A damp towel reused within 24 hours can carry millions of bacteria, including the same strains linked to acne and skin irritation. If reuse is unavoidable, hang to fully dry between uses and never share.
Yes — for hygiene, the answer is unambiguous. A single-use disposable towel removes the variable of bacterial buildup entirely. Washcloths, even when laundered, can re-contaminate from the wash cycle, ambient air, and storage.

It can absolutely contribute. Acne-prone skin is more vulnerable to bacterial colonization, and the friction + bacteria combination from a contaminated towel is a known irritation trigger. A clean towel won't cure acne, but a dirty one demonstrably makes it harder to resolve.
